Delta Tire & LubeBusiness BookmarkContact InformationYpao Road, Tamuning 96913, Guam671-646-2797 Get Directions By car By public transit Walking Bicycling Detailed InformationAirport 76: 671-642-3582 Ypao 76: 671-649-3582 Barrigada 76: 671-735-3582